We continue to provide innovative care models, focused on improving quality and access to healthcare.ResponsibilitiesWellstar Cobb Hospital has an immediate opportunity for a Registered Nurse (RN) in the Emergency Department.The Registered Nurse (RN) Emergency Department is a proactive member of an interdisciplinary team of licensed and unlicensed care givers who ensure that patients, families and significant others receive individualized high quality, safe patient care. They practice in a clinical environment that is administered by Nurse Managers and other leaders and is supported through the WellStar Shared Governance Model.The framework for practice is steered by the WellStar Professional Practice Model, 5-Star Nursing and evidence based practice and research. RN competencies are derived from these models and supported by the WellStar Core Competencies.QualificationsRequired Minimum Education : Graduate of an accredited/approved school of nursing: Baccalaureate degree in nursing (BSN) from an accredited school of nursing preferred.Required Minimum Licensure/Certification : Current/active license as a registered nurse in the State of Georgia.Must have a current ACLS and BLS card from the American Heart Association on the first day of employment.National certification in area of specialty preferred.Required Minimum Experience : Experience with direct patient care preferred.Required Minimum Skills:Ability to read, write and speak English language, optimize the use of technology to support clinical care and holds basic computer skills; Strong interpersonal, collaborative skills along with customer service skills required; Ability to function in a fast paced environment and respond to emergencies in using a decisive, composed and respectful manner; Possess excellent time management skills; practices nursing using evidence and analytical skills along with possessing strong critical thinking skills.Join us for outstanding benefits and development opportunities.
